A Man Called Otto

2022 · Movie · PG-13 · 126 min · ★ 7.8 · 61% critics

ComedyDrama

A grumpy widower clashes with the arrival of a lively young family next door, especially a quick-witted pregnant woman who pushes him to change. As their unexpected bond grows, his rigid routine begins to unravel, turning everyday life into something far more surprising and heartfelt.

Based on A Man Called Ove

Also known as La Vie Selon Otto

About

You’ll likely enjoy A Man Called Otto if you want a funny-yet-tearful tale of unlikely friendship and finding meaning after loss, but Not for you if you’re sensitive to very dark themes, multiple on-screen suicide attempts, or strong preachiness like Instant Family.

Pros: heartfelt grief story; strong lead performance; warm neighbor chemistry | Cons: very dark moments; heavy emotional tone; can feel preachy
